The financial services industry is undergoing a digital revolution, driven by advancements in technology. Fintech (financial technology) has emerged as a disruptor, transforming the way we manage money, make payments, invest, and access financial services. Behind the scenes, fintech software development plays a crucial role in enabling these innovations. In this article, we will explore the top technologies for fintech software development that are shaping the future of financial services.

Artificial Intelligence (AI) and Machine Learning (ML):

Artificial Intelligence and Machine Learning have become integral to fintech software development. AI-powered algorithms can analyze vast amounts of financial data, detect patterns, and generate insights for risk assessment, fraud detection, and investment strategies. Machine Learning algorithms continuously learn from data, improving their accuracy and effectiveness over time. In fintech, AI and ML are used in areas such as chatbots for customer service, credit scoring, personalized financial recommendations, and algorithmic trading.

Blockchain Technology:

Blockchain technology, known for its decentralized and transparent nature, has disrupted the financial industry by revolutionizing security, transparency, and efficiency. Blockchain enables secure and tamper-proof transactions, eliminates intermediaries, reduces costs, and improves transaction speed. It has the potential to transform areas such as cross-border payments, remittances, smart contracts, and identity verification. Blockchain technology is gaining traction in fintech software development due to its ability to provide trust and security in financial transactions.

Robotic Process Automation (RPA):

Robotic Process Automation automates repetitive and rule-based tasks, reducing human error, improving efficiency, and enhancing compliance. In fintech, RPA is used for automating account opening processes, customer onboarding, data entry, regulatory compliance, and fraud detection. By automating these tasks, fintech companies can streamline operations, reduce costs, and allocate human resources to more value-added activities

Cloud Computing:

Cloud computing has revolutionized the way software applications are developed and deployed. Fintech companies can leverage cloud infrastructure to scale their applications, store and process large amounts of data securely, and provide seamless access to financial services across devices. Cloud computing offers flexibility, scalability, cost-efficiency, and robust security measures, making it an ideal choice for fintech software development.

Internet of Things (IoT):

The Internet of Things (IoT) is creating new opportunities in fintech by connecting devices, sensors, and wearables to financial services. IoT devices enable real-time data collection, personalized offers, and contextual financial services. In fintech, IoT is utilized for connected payments, smart banking, insurance telematics, and personalized financial management. IoT devices generate vast amounts of data, which can be leveraged for data analytics and improved decision-making.

Data Analytics and Big Data:

The availability of large volumes of financial data presents immense opportunities for fintech software development. Data analytics and big data technologies enable fintech companies to extract insights, detect patterns, and make data-driven decisions. By analyzing customer behavior, transaction data, and market trends, fintech companies can offer personalized financial services, fraud detection, risk assessment, and investment recommendations. Data analytics and big data technologies empower fintech companies to create a competitive edge and enhance customer experiences.

Biometrics and Authentication:

In the era of digital financial services, security and authentication are paramount. Biometric technologies, such as fingerprint recognition, facial recognition, and voice recognition, provide secure and convenient authentication methods. Fintech software development incorporates biometric authentication to enhance security and protect user identities. Biometric authentication is widely used in mobile banking apps, payment gateways, and identity verification processes.


The top technologies for fintech software development are driving unprecedented innovation and transforming the financial services industry. Artificial Intelligence, blockchain technology, robotic process automation, cloud computing, Internet of Things, data analytics, and biometrics are revolutionizing how we manage money, access financial services, and make transactions. Fintech companies that embrace these technologies can gain a competitive edge, improve operational efficiency, deliver personalized financial services, and enhance the overall customer experience. As these technologies continue to evolve, fintech software development will play a crucial role in shaping the future of finance, making it more accessible, secure, and customer-centric.